Job description

Glen Raven is recruiting for a Trainer. This role is responsible for the implementation of operator skills training for production and secondary jobs. Assist in the revision of all related training/safety manuals and process improvement projects. Conducts new hire safety orientation and associate safety meetings.

Responsibilities: 

  • Assists in the development and preparation of training materials and manuals.
  • Plan, schedule and implement training duties for operator and support jobs on each shift.
  • Provide Department Section Leaders with timely updates on all related trainee problems or issues relating to trainee performance and/or safety concerns.
  • Assist in the records retention of Training Department documentation.
  • Conduct additional/special training classes (day and occasional evenings) in order to enhance awareness of and compliance with OSHA regulations, procedures and/or company policies.
  • Assist with safety documentation, including, but not limited to, safety training, training logs and Behavioral Based Safety (BBS) administration.
  • Assist with general HR functions as directed by the Human Resources/Safety Manager.
  • Ability to function with a personal computer and utilize Microsoft Windows/Office software.
  • Ability to work independently, as well as in a team-oriented environment.
  • Ability to multi-task and work in a constantly changing environment.
  • Maintain confidentiality with regard to all HR functions.
  • Ability to communicate/interact with associates and management personnel.
  • Ability to perform job duties in a safe manner.

**This position is Monday - Friday, 7am-4pm, with approved overtime.
